Hyperliquid Partnership Anchored by nHYPE and USDe

Ethena Labs described the collaboration with Nunchi as a direct step toward deeper Hyperliquid integrations. The group noted that Nunchi will launch all initial markets with USDe as the quote asset, allowing traders to earn a rate on margin while taking yield-based positions. 

Ethena also said a portion of Nunchi’s revenue will support its ecosystem. The team added that a potential Nunchi airdrop may reach the ecosystem if a token launches.

Nunchi’s role extends into Hyperliquid’s HIP-3 deployment framework. The team stated that its bond will rely on community-staked HYPE, converted into nHYPE through a dedicated contract. 

nHYPE becomes a liquid staking token that tracks the staked position while giving holders flexibility across the Hyperliquid environment. Stakers also earn cHIPs, with weekly snapshots forming part of Nunchi’s points system.

Hyperliquid requires a sizable HYPE bond for HIP-3 deployment, according to Nunchi’s announcement. The team explained that this creates a capital burden for new markets and limits liquidity for community members. 

nHYPE addresses this issue by keeping staked HYPE productive and liquid. Participants can trade or move nHYPE without unlocking the core stake used to back the bond.

Ethena referenced its earlier investment in BasedOneX, another Hyperliquid builder, noting that sENA holders receive Based Points. The group pointed to the presence of USDe across the HyperEVM ecosystem, including most major applications. 

The team said it continues to explore new collaborations with HIP-3 deployers and ecosystem contributors. Nunchi, in turn, prepares to open its cHIPs game alongside the nHYPE launch cycle.

Hyperliquid Bond Timeline Sets the Stage for Nov. 28

Nunchi said nHYPE goes live on November 28, marking the first window for early stakers. 

Users with natively staked HYPE must exit their positions now due to the seven-day unstake period. The team emphasized that early involvement brings stronger multipliers through cHIPs. 

The process begins by connecting a wallet, staking HYPE, and minting nHYPE at a one-to-one ratio.

Hyperliquid becomes the central venue for this rollout. The launch will determine how quickly Nunchi secures the HIP-3 bond and activates its yield exchange. Ethena and Nunchi both framed the release as part of a coordinated push to expand activity inside Hyperliquid. 

According to their updates, the shift aims to unlock broader access to yield markets and liquid staking across the network.

Both the Fed and the BoC are expected to lower interest rates. USD/CAD forms a Head and Shoulder chart pattern. The USD/CAD pair ticks up to near 1.3760 during the late European session on Wednesday. The Loonie pair gains marginally ahead of monetary policy outcomes by the Bank of Canada (BoC) and the Federal Reserve (Fed) during New York trading hours. Both the BoC and the Fed are expected to cut interest rates amid mounting labor market conditions in their respective economies. Inflationary pressures in the Canadian economy have cooled down, emerging as another reason behind the BoC’s dovish expectations. However, the Fed is expected to start the monetary-easing campaign despite the United States (US) inflation remaining higher. Investors will closely monitor press conferences from both Fed Chair Jerome Powell and BoC Governor Tiff Macklem to get cues about whether there will be more interest rate cuts in the remainder of the year. According to analysts from Barclays, the Fed’s latest median projections for interest rates are likely to call for three interest rate cuts by 2025. Ahead of the Fed’s monetary policy, the US Dollar Index (DXY), which tracks the Greenback’s value against six major currencies, holds onto Tuesday’s losses near 96.60. USD/CAD forms a Head and Shoulder chart pattern, which indicates a bearish reversal. The neckline of the above-mentioned chart pattern is plotted near 1.3715. The near-term trend of the pair remains bearish as it stays below the 20-day Exponential Moving Average (EMA), which trades around 1.3800. The 14-day Relative Strength Index (RSI) slides to near 40.00. A fresh bearish momentum would emerge if the RSI falls below that level.
